Remove 2020 Remove Computer Science Remove Java Remove Programming Language
article thumbnail

Data Scientist vs Full Stack Developer: What to Choose?

Knowledge Hut

Language Recommendation Photoshop, HTML, CSS, JAVASCRIPT, PYTHON, ANGULAR, NODE.JS Job Market: It was predicted that by 2020, the demand for data scientists will have increased by 28%. In LinkedIn's 2020 Emerging Jobs Report, the "Full stack engineer" role is ranked fourth among the top emerging jobs for 2020.

article thumbnail

Top Software Engineer Skills You Should Have in 2024

Knowledge Hut

These experts are well-versed in programming languages, have access to databases, and have a broad understanding of topics like operating systems, debugging, and algorithms. Software engineers create software solutions for end users based on engineering principles and programming languages.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

Back-End Developer Job Opportunities in 2024 [Career Options]

Knowledge Hut

With the rise of web-based companies, mobile applications, and cloud computing, there has never been a greater demand for skilled experts fluent in programming languages like Python, Java, and Ruby on Rails. Salary: The average salary for Java backend developers is around $95 thousand per year.

article thumbnail

Top 30 Machine Learning Skills for ML Engineer in 2024

Knowledge Hut

million jobs in machine learning would be available across the globe by 2020. Computer Science Fundamentals and Programming It is important that a machine learning engineer apply the concepts of computer science and programming correctly as the situation demands.

article thumbnail

Who is an Application Software Engineer? Skills, Responsibilities, Salary

Knowledge Hut

Qualifications To Be an Application Software Engineer A bachelor's degree in software engineering, computer science, or a similar discipline is important. The most popular degree programs are in computer science because they typically cover a wide range of subjects. Code testing finds mistakes.

article thumbnail

Top 7 Data Engineering Career Opportunities in 2024

Knowledge Hut

Data engineering involves a lot of technical skills like Python, Java, and SQL (Structured Query Language). As a data engineer, a strong understanding of programming, databases, and data processing is necessary. Understanding of Big Data technologies such as Hadoop, Spark, and Kafka. Knowledge of Hadoop, Spark, and Kafka.

article thumbnail

Cyber Security vs Data Science: Key Difference & Similarities

Knowledge Hut

Data science is a practice that involves extracting valuable insights and information from vast amounts of unorganized data. This is achieved through the application of advanced techniques, which require proficiency in domain knowledge, basic programming skills (such as Python, R, and Java), and understanding of mathematical concepts.